Output 8bbbefa2d6da910df7f185b5dadda9016f192b529e888e6c1bc1d1e05bf79879:0

value
870658334
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 861aca757b5cb37af0edaaebc90291bf19d737632f2dbce04daaac145620c1cd
address
tb1pscdv5atmtjeh4u8d4t4ujq53huvawdmr9ukmeczd42kpg43qc8xsdx73v6
transaction
8bbbefa2d6da910df7f185b5dadda9016f192b529e888e6c1bc1d1e05bf79879
confirmations
30366
spent
true